June Garen

June Garen is a retired nurse who spent much of her career in the operating room—where precision and patience were essential, skills that come in handy with knitting needles too. She learned to knit at her grandmother’s side, a Dutch woman who knew that knitting wasn’t just a pastime, but a survival skill during long, cold winters.

Since then, June has happily knitted her way through life and shared the craft wherever she could—at local libraries, with community knitting groups, and even at the county jail. She loves that knitting invites experimentation with colors and textures and rewards you with the ultimate prize: wearable art. At Kimball Jenkins, she’s excited to bring her “Humble Knitting” class to anyone who wants to make something beautiful, useful, and maybe even a little bit quirky—one stitch at a time.
